He who observes the wind will not sow,


And he who regards the clouds will not reap.   Ecclesiastes 11:4


Our first week is coming to an end.  Looking at diligence has helped me focus on my life with spiritual eyes and see areas that need work.  It's easy to become discouraged when I open my eyes and look honestly at myself, but becoming discouraged only happens when I forget all the strength and love from my Father that is at my disposal - when I change my focus from God to myself or my circumstances.   Diligence is hard, but...

And let us not grow weary while doing good, for in due season we shall reap if we do not lose heart.    Galatians 6:9

Next week we will begin looking at specific areas which we are told by Peter to diligently add to our spiritual walk.  We will study what this looks like in a different woman each week.  By looking at various women in differing circumstances I hope to learn how to make application no matter what season of life or situation I find myself in.
